Is blaming someone truly helping us to solve a problem? - No Blame Game, Follow the Science
In this conversation with Professor Michaéla Schippers, we explore the psychological impact of blame. What does blaming someone give us? What happens to the person being blamed? Does blame bring us closer to a solution for the problem at hand?
Perhaps there’s a better path forward—reconciliation.
Reconciliation shifts the focus from assigning blame to rebuilding trust, understanding, and finding common ground. Blame often shuts doors to dialogue and potential solutions, while reconciliation opens them. If we want to solve problems and create lasting change, we must focus on keeping the dialogue open. Only through reconciliation can we pave the way to constructive outcomes and a better future.
